Pipeline bottlenecks, pricing reforms key to India’s natural gas push, says IGU

in5points
  1. India aims to boost natural gas use by addressing pipeline bottlenecks and market bottlenecks rather than expanding LNG terminals.

  2. The International Gas Union (IGU) emphasizes pipeline investment as a key factor for India's natural gas push.

  3. Pricing reforms and supply diversification are identified as critical for sustainable growth of natural gas in India.
